Tongzhou's industrial upgrade pays off
Tongzhou district in Nantong has made significant achievements in industrial optimization and upgrading.
In the first five months of this year, the profits of its enterprises above designated size saw a 12.2-percent year-on-year increase. It is currently home to 242 such firms in strategic emerging sectors. Their industrial output has contributed 37.8 percent to the total industrial value of enterprises above designated size.
Tongzhou has excelled in cultivating key industrial chains. For example, its semiconductor sector has attracted industry leaders like Zhongkeyi (Nantong) Semiconductor Equipment Co, China's leading manufacturer of semiconductor dry vacuum pumps, and Pi Semiconductor (Nantong) Co, which boasts world-class test substrate technology for automatic testing equipment.
Tongzhou has also been exploring new frontiers in future industries. For instance, in the first half of this year, it added artificial intelligence to its list of priority industries. Leveraging its strengths in advanced home textiles, intelligent equipment, and new materials, the district will allocate resources to future-oriented industries, including aerospace, advanced equipment, energy, new materials, and communications, with a focus on sub-sectors such as the low-altitude economy, new energy storage, and cutting-edge semiconductors.
